WebFirstly, building codes and zoning laws vary by location and can impact where and how a tiny house can be built and lived. Failure to comply with these regulations can result in fines, legal action, or even the removal of the tiny house. Secondly, land use and property ownership regulations can impact the ability to lease or own tiny house land.

Pros and Cons of Tiny House A-Frames Like any architectural style, A-frame tiny houses come with a list of pros and cons. WebWhy go log framing? The aesthetic would be the primary reason. You don’t see many log framed tiny houses. Another advantage is ease of construction. Instead of stick framing and working with all these different layers, these walls are only one layer and go up very quickly, saving on costs. underground detection mapping
